    VACANCY ANNOUNCEMENT

    SENIOR PLANNER-TRANSPORTATION                 CO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T & PLANNING

    The Community Development & Planning Department seeks an individual to provide planning analysis of transportation projects and initiatives, coordinates the Town's transportation functions, implementation of transportation management association (TMA), staff support to the Watertown Bicycle and Pedestrian Committee, prepares monthly information packages for the Planning Board and Zoning Board of Appeals. This senior planner writes reports, reviews plans and legal documents and makes recommendations.  Coordinates with the Department of Public Works, Mass DOT, MBTA and others.  Coordinates transportation policy and planning efforts for the Town with private and non-profit developers as well as other Town and State offices.  Supports other long and short range planning efforts.


    Required Minimum Qualifications

    Bachelor's degree in Urban Planning or Transportation Planning related field and 3 years of transportation planning experience, Masters Degree preferred,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.  Computer skills and a valid Massachusetts driver's license with good driving record.

    The Town of Grafton is accepting applications for the position of Assistant
    Town Planner.  Under the direction of the Town Planner, this position is
    responsible for providing technical support to the Planning
    Board/Department and performs a variety of duties related to current and
    long-range planning and development within the Town.  Assists with: review
    of land use/development applications; updating of various Town development
    regulations and plans; conducting studies and analyses regarding various
    planning and development issues; and, providing technical assistance to
    planning and development-related Town boards and committees.  Familiarity
    with Massachusetts Affordable Housing, Subdivision Control Law, and Zoning
    Act (MGL c.40A) desirable.  Strong oral and written communication skills,
    and experience with word processing, spreadsheets, and databases is
    required.

    Minimum qualifications: Bachelor?s Degree in Planning, Geography, Public
    Administration or related field, and three years of planning-related
    experience, preferably in municipal government.  A Master?s Degree in one
    of the above fields may be substituted for two years of experience.  Salary
    range:  $34,811 ? $59,179, with benefits, DOQ.

    New Bedford City Planner
    The City of New Bedford is embarking on a series of significant new planning initiatives for which it seeks an experienced, visionary and talented city planner.  From the adoption of new form-based zoning and the generation of a new Waterfront Plan with Urban Renewal Areas to the development of an Innovation District, New Bedford is embracing new opportunities that demand a professional planner with exceptional skills.

    The City Planner will be expected to lead the City's planning office, a division of the Department of Planning, Housing & Community Development, working with City boards and overseeing staff while participating as a team player in city development projects and community initiatives.

    Environmental/Urban Planner

    Fort Point Associates, Inc.  Company LocationBoston, Massachusetts

    Job description

    The Environmental/Urban Planner will work on a range of tasks associated with planning activities and project permitting, including: 

    • Managing project approvals for smaller scale projects 
    • Preparing and producing environmental and planning documents and permit applications. 
    • Conducting research and drafting text, maps, and graphics for planning and permitting documents. 
    • Organizational support for project team and public meetings, including developing schedules, sending notifications, drafting agendas, and preparing permit documents. 
    • Research and documentation for planning initiatives and development project permitting. 
    • Drafting text for planning initiatives and permitting documents. 
    • Attendance at and logistical coordination for community meetings, including preparation of presentation materials.
